Just another Question: Are .ipf files the same as SPS ? Or can I change .ipf files to SPS files ? Sorry if thats a noobish question, but I am quite new to that Thank you |
12 August 2008, 22:05 | #4 |
Lesser Talent
Join Date: Jan 2003
Location: UK
Age: 42
Posts: 7,957
|
SPS = Software Preservation Society, they are the guys who create the IPF (Interchangeable Preservation Format) files
So yes they are the same. |
